APD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

1,674 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Air Products & Chemicals (APD)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$50.1B — up 9.6% from $45.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 156 funds opened new APD positions and 112 closed out — a net gain of 44 holders — while 647 added to existing stakes and 626 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$939M. The largest seller was Wells Fargo, cutting an estimated $425M.
